Answer:

Vertical distance from the Origin to Point [tex]P(6,3)[/tex] is equal to [tex]3\ units.[/tex]

Step-by-step explanation:

Diagram of given scenario is shown below.

To find:- What is vertical distance from the origin to point [tex](6,3)[/tex].

Given that: point [tex]P(6,3)[/tex] and [tex]O(0,0)[/tex].

Now,

from the Diagram it is easy to say that Vertical Distance becomes [tex]PA[/tex] when Point [tex]O[/tex] shifted to point [tex]A[/tex] ( on x-axis y-coordinate is always zero ).

So, Distance between two points calculated such as :

                  Distance = [tex]\sqrt{(x_{2} - x_{1} )^{2} + (y_{2}-y_{1} )^{2} }[/tex]

Then,        [tex]PA=\sqrt{(6-6)^{2}+(3-0)^{2} } = \sqrt{3^{2} } \\\\PA= 3\ units[/tex]

Therefore,

Vertical distance from the Origin to Point [tex]P(6,3)[/tex] is equal to [tex]3\ units.[/tex]
